eviCore Healthcare MSI, LLC seeks an Application Development Advisor for the Atlanta, GA location to work with internal teams to design, develop and maintain software. Responsibilities: • Produce code using .net languages such as C# and VB. • Create requirement-based applications, configure existing systems, and provide user support. • Write clean, scalable code using .NET programming languages, and remain up to date with the terminology, concepts and best practices for coding mobile apps. • Develop technical interfaces, specifications, and architecture, use and adapt existing web applications for apps, and create and test software prototypes. • Develop client displays and user interfaces, assist software personnel in handling project related work and other requirements, and coordinate with other software professionals and developers. • May be asked to supervise a small team of software engineers. • Hybrid work schedule. Qualifications: • Master’s degree in Computer Science or related field and 3 years of experience in any software engineering role. Will also accept a Bachelor’s degree and 5 years of experience. • Must have experience with: C#. Net Development; • SQL Server Database; • Azure Cloud Services including App Service Environments and Azure Functions; • Cosmos DB Services; • Troubleshooting and Debugging Windows based services; • Windows Services hosted on Microsoft Windows Server v2019; • Rally Software Development Lifecycle; • Windows hosted IIS API Development; • JSON Data Streams; • XML Data Streams; • Artificial intelligence for code generation and test case development; • Developing processes that generate and analyze PDF documents; • Secure FTP file transfer protocols; and • Implementing API security including Auth0 and OAuth. If you will be working at home occasionally or permanently, the internet connection must be obtained through a cable broadband or fiber optic internet service provider with speeds of at least 10Mbps download/5Mbps upload. **Ab
